2T.03 Specications
A. Torch Congurations
1. Hand/Manual Torch, Model
SL60QD™
The hand torch head is at 75° to the torch
handle. The hand torches include a torch
handle and torch trigger assembly.
2. Mechanized Torch, Model
The standard machine torch has a po-
sitioning tube with rack & pinch block
assembly.
B. Torch Leads Lengths
Hand Torches are available as follows:
• 20 ft / 6.1 m, with ATC connectors
• 50 ft / 15.2 m, with ATC connectors
Machine Torches are available as
follows:
• 5 foot / 1.5 m, with ATC connectors
• 10 foot / 3.05 m, with ATC connectors
• 25 foot / 7.6 m, with ATC connectors
• 50 foot / 15.2 m, with ATC connectors
C. Torch Parts
Starter Cartridge, Electrode, Tip, Shield Cup
D. Parts - In - Place (PIP)
Torch Head has built - in switch
15 VDC circuit rating
E. Type Cooling
Combination of ambient air and gas stream
through torch.
